What Does an Automotive Locksmith Do?

310762719_174097598533869_2015889089625884380_nlow.jpgAutomotive locksmiths are professionals who can help people lock and unlock their vehicles. They can install new locks or reprogram the locks to allow greater access to their vehicles. They can cut transponder keys, and replace the normal car locks.

Cut a transponder-key

Making a transponder-key for an automotive locksmith requires the right equipment. This includes an ultra-secure key cutter and a thorough understanding of the key.

A professional can also program a key. The key's RFID chip communicates with the vehicle's immobilizer. When the ID code matches, the immobilizer is disabled.

Transponder keys can also be programmed to different vehicles. Certain cars require specialized software, while others have an integrated system. Dealers usually charge $150-200 for each key. However, a skilled locksmith will be able to complete the job at a fraction of the price.

If you require a lock cut replacement, programmed, or cut, a professional locksmith will complete the task quickly. A locksmith can also take out any old keys from your car's system.

During the late 90s, the automotive industry started using transponder keys. They provide an additional security layer as well as making the lock more difficult to pick. Apart from providing security to your vehicle they are also known to be more durable than old keys made of metal.
